The Bachelor's program Media Informatics is divided into 3 sections:

  • In semesters 1 - 4, we teach you not only the necessary basics, but also the most important profile-building skills for the degree program.
  • Semesters 5 - 6 serve to deepen and specialize in exactly those areas that are of particular interest to you. Here you can put together your own study plan from our extensive catalog of subjects.
  • The 7th semester is the practical semester in which you will complete a project and bachelor thesis.

Semester 1

  • Fundamentals of design
  • Animation 2D+3D
  • Basics of programming
  • Basics of information technology
  • Discrete mathematics
  • Successful studies

Semester 2

  • Interface and interaction design
  • Film
  • Web Development Basics
  • Software Engineering
  • Algorithms and Data Structures
  • Statistics

Semester 3

  • Software Engineering and Game Design
  • Virtual Reality and Augmented Reality
  • IT Security
  • Databases
  • Design, communication and presentation

Semester 4

  • Web Development, Web Design and Usability
  • User Experience Design
  • Applied Artificial Intelligence
  • Computer Networks
  • English for Computer Scientists

Semester 5 and 6

  • Digital Ethics
  • Interdisciplinary Software Development Project

Examples of elective modules:

  • Game Design 3D
  • Immersive Technologies
  • Human Interface Design
  • Transformation Design
  • Photo project
  • Audio technology
  • Project management
  • Modern App and Web Development
  • RESTful Web Services
  • Software quality management
  • Applied machine learning
  • Data analysis and data mining
  • Robotics
  • Internet of Things
  • Basic medical diagnostics
  • Practical beekeeping
  • Model flying

Semester 7

  • Practical Project
  • Bachelor Thesis

Media Informatics

Degree awarded
B.Sc.
Department
Computer Science
Duration
7 semesters
Start
Winter semester
Application period

July 15

Tuition fees
none
Language of instruction
German
Campus
Hof
